How to make Turkey Sausage & Pepper Egg Muffins

Ingredients

  • 12 eggs
  • ½ Tbsp avocado oil
  • 1 green bell pepper (diced)
  • 16 oz ground turkey sausage
  • 1 tsp kosher salt
  • ½ tsp garlic powder
  • ½ tsp black pepper

Directions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Heat the avocado oil in a pan over medium heat.
  3. Add the diced bell pepper to the pan, sautéing until it becomes tender.
  4. Remove the cooked peppers from the pan.
  5. In the same pan, brown the ground turkey sausage.
  6. While the sausage is cooking, whisk together the eggs, sautéed bell pepper, kosher salt, garlic powder, and black pepper.
  7. Spoon about 2 tablespoons of the browned turkey sausage into each cup of a 12-muffin pan.
  8. Pour the egg mixture over the sausage in the muffin tin.
  9. Bake in the preheated oven for 20 minutes.
  10. Let cool slightly, then enjoy your Turkey Sausage & Pepper Egg Muffins!

How to serve Turkey Sausage & Pepper Egg Muffins

These muffins can be served warm or at room temperature. They make a great breakfast on their own or can be paired with fruit for a complete meal. You can also enjoy them as a snack or lunch option.

How to store Turkey Sausage & Pepper Egg Muffins

To store the muffins, let them cool completely first. Place them in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They will stay fresh for about 4-5 days. You can also freeze them for longer storage. To reheat, simply pop them in the microwave for about 30-60 seconds.

Tips to make Turkey Sausage & Pepper Egg Muffins

  • Use different types of bell peppers for a colorful twist.
  • Try adding cheese for extra flavor.
  • Ensure the muffin pan is well-greased to prevent sticking.
  • You can customize the spice level by adding diced jalapeños or your favorite hot sauce.

Variation

You can easily modify this recipe by substituting the turkey sausage with chicken sausage or plant-based sausage for a healthier or vegetarian option. You can also add different vegetables like spinach, zucchini, or mushrooms to fit your taste.

FAQs

Can I use egg whites instead of whole eggs?
Yes, you can use egg whites to make the muffins lower in calories and fat, but the texture may be slightly different.

Can I make these muffins in advance?
Absolutely! These muffins are great for meal prep. You can make them ahead of time and enjoy them throughout the week.

What other meats can I use in this recipe?
You can use any ground meat you prefer, such as chicken, pork, or beef. Just ensure it is cooked through before adding it to the muffins.
